Fresh Salad with Quinoa and Brewer’s Yeast – Honey Dressing

Why it’s worth trying

Iceberg lettuce adds freshness, quinoa provides satiety and plant-based protein, avocado supplies healthy fats, and brewer’s yeast flakes not only enhance the flavor but also enrich your diet with B-group vitamins and essential minerals. This is a light yet well-balanced meal, perfect for lunch or dinner.

Ingredients

  • 100 g iceberg lettuce
  • 100 g cherry tomatoes
  • 1/2 small red onion
  • 1 avocado
  • 100 g cooked quinoa
  • Juice of 1 lime
  • 2 teaspoons honey
  • 15 g brewer’s yeast flakes
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Preparation

Tear the iceberg lettuce by hand and place it in a bowl.

Add the halved cherry tomatoes and finely chopped red onion.

Add the sliced avocado and cooked quinoa.

Squeeze over the lime juice and season with salt and pepper.

In a separate small bowl, mix the honey with the brewer’s yeast flakes.

Drizzle the dressing over the salad, gently toss, and serve immediately.
